Frequently Asked Questions

How do I start an integration between Google Blogger and cardly?

To start, connect both your Google Blogger and cardly accounts to viaSocket. Once connected, you can set up a workflow where an event in Google Blogger triggers actions in cardly (or vice versa).

Can we customize how data from Google Blogger is recorded in cardly?

Absolutely. You can customize how Google Blogger data is recorded in cardly. This includes choosing which data fields go into which fields of cardly, setting up custom formats, and filtering out unwanted information.

How often does the data sync between Google Blogger and cardly?

The data sync between Google Blogger and cardly typically happens in real-time through instant triggers. And a maximum of 15 minutes in case of a scheduled trigger.

Can I filter or transform data before sending it from Google Blogger to cardly?

Yes, viaSocket allows you to add custom logic or use built-in filters to modify data according to your needs.

Is it possible to add conditions to the integration between Google Blogger and cardly?

Yes, you can set conditional logic to control the flow of data between Google Blogger and cardly. For instance, you can specify that data should only be sent if certain conditions are met, or you can create if/else statements to manage different outcomes.

About Google Blogger

Blogger is a popular online platform that allows users to create and manage their own blogs. It provides a user-friendly interface for writing, editing, and publishing blog posts, making it accessible for both beginners and experienced bloggers. With customizable templates and various design options, users can personalize their blogs to reflect their unique style and content.
